Fairview Golden Boulder Mining CompanyStock Certificate
The Fairview Golden Boulder Company was incorporated in Nevada on April 25, 1906. The company's operations were located in Fairview, which was located in the western central portion of the state. Fairview actually changed locations twice, once to move closer to the mines and mills in which the town's residents worked, and once because the town outgrew the narrow canyon in which the second ...town was sited. It is currently a ghost town. One of the few remnants of the old town is the bank vault from the first town site's bank; the vault can be seen from the nearby Austin-Lincoln Highway.
The town grew as a result from a discovery of ore in 1904. The town was prosperous from 1907 to 1912. The post office closed 1919.
